This subject has been discussed many times, but I can't get an answer for Outlook 2013. I have a number of address lists in Outlook from iCloud and Contacts. When I enter the first letter of the "To Field" last name my wife's Outlook will list all potential recipients beginning with first letter, with the list growing smaller as she enters more of the name. She finally selects one, and goes onto the next name. On my pc, I have to go into the actual lists to select a name and email address, Outlook will not populate the "To Field." Even after she sends out the email, the system remembers the email address, and will not supply it from the contact or recipients list, and the email address will at times not be known from memory. Any help in clearing this up will be greatly appreciated.
